Blood pressure refers to the force exerted by blood on artery walls as it circulates throughout the body’s circulatory system. It is measured in millimeters of mercury (mmHg) and is expressed in two values – systolic blood pressure and diastolic blood pressure.

Systolic blood pressure reflects the pressure in the arteries when the heart contracts and pumps blood, while diastolic blood pressure represents the pressure when the heart relaxes between beats. Normal blood pressure values are typically around 120/80 mmHg, although they can vary from person to person.

Regular monitoring of blood pressure is vital for our well-being. Elevated blood pressure, known as hypertension, is considered a significant risk factor for numerous health conditions, including heart disease, stroke, kidney failure, and vascular problems.

Often referred to as “the silent killer,” hypertension often exhibits no obvious symptoms, and individuals can live with high blood pressure for years without realizing it until serious complications arise. Therefore, regular blood pressure measurements are essential to detect any abnormalities promptly and allow for timely intervention.

Blood pressure can be measured either by a doctor during regular check-ups or at home using devices such as a sphygmomanometer. To obtain accurate results, it is essential to adhere to a few simple guidelines. These include:

1. Rest: Prior to measuring blood pressure, it is advisable to rest for at least five minutes in a comfortable position.
2. Free Arm: Ensure that the arm being used is free from clothing or any devices that could compress the arteries.
3. Correct Positioning: Sit with a straight back, feet planted on the floor, and the arm resting on a stable surface, palm facing up.
4. Regular Measurements: Take at least two measurements 1-2 minutes apart and record the most accurate values.

Blood pressure can be effectively managed through a combination of lifestyle changes and, if necessary, the use of prescribed medications. Here are some helpful tips for controlling blood pressure:

1. Balanced Nutrition: Follow a di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and low in saturated fats and sodium.
2. Regular Physical Activity: Engage in at least 30 minutes of moderate physical activity daily, such as walking, swimming, or yoga.
3. Maintain a Healthy Weight: Overweight and obesity increase the risk of high blood pressure, so it is essential to maintain a healthy weight.
4. Limit Alcohol Consumption: Excessive alcohol consumption can elevate blood pressure, so it is advisable to limit intake.
5. Stress Management: Employ relaxation techniques such as meditation or yoga to manage stress, which can help keep blood pressure in check.

It is crucial to consult a healthcare professional for regular check-ups and to determine the need for any drug therapies.
